Main responsibilities:

Provide Pharmacovigilance (PV) and risk management expertise to internal and external customersAct as a safety expert for products and maintain knowledge of products, product environment, and recent literatureMaintain PV expertise, and understanding of international safety regulations and guidelinesLead cross functional Safety Management Teams (SMTs)Communicate with and represent PV position within project/product teams, with external partners and Health AuthoritiesProvide strategic and proactive safety input into development plansSupport due diligence activities and pharmacovigilance agreementsResponsible for signal detection and analysisCo-lead benefit-risk assessment with other relevant functionsEnsure generation, consistency, and quality of safety sections in submission documentsWrite responses or contributions to health authorities’ questions

About you

Advanced degree in a medical or scientific field (ideally MD)Extensive experience in pharmacovigilance and risk managementClinical experienceIn-depth knowledge of international safety regulations and guidelinesStrong leadership skills with the ability to lead cross-functional teamsExcellent communication skills, both written and verbalProven ability to analyze complex safety data and develop strategic safety plansFluency in English; additional languages are a plus
